Jojobaa's analysis: Impairments are done relative to investments made, it is not an operating loss per se, but rather a loss relative to the investments made. A company should be valued based on its future prospect, rather than its past investments. Impairments are done so the future cash flow of Kraken should be valued, not the impairments. In fact, impairments will boost up future profits via savings of depreciation of 1.6 billion during its life span.
Impairments are done based on a set of DCF calculations, which has assumptions bearing cash flow, contracts, extensions and oil prices. If circumstances change with relevance to this, or if present conditions are worse off than management's and auditor's expectations, then impairments can happen. Even Exxon impair billions, but again it is with respect to past investments made, not future cash flow, thereby a NON CASH FLOW EXPENSE.

Jojobaa's analysis: According to the annual report and press releases, Armada CEO has said that FPSO business is relatively immune to oil prices. I wrote something about this above, maybe you should read it. The only way oil can affect FPSO business is if the oil prices are sustained at below cash flow break even for a PROLONGED period of time. Hope you understand that oil prices only affect the sentiment and future potential project decisions but not necessarily the results that Armada is running day to day.
